The Sales Supervisor will lead the day to day sales management for DTG’s (Disney Theatrical Group) touring productions of The Lion King, and Beauty and the Beast, in the UK/Ireland. The primary focus is to deliver the ticket revenue objectives and manage the ticket inventory for each market whilst building and maintaining venue relationships. This is a full time opportunity offered on a fixed term contract to cover a maternity leave.

The Sales Supervisor will work closely with both the DTG (Disney Theatrical Group) and venue marketing/sales teams to ensure sales strategies are aligned and that all teams are working towards joint goals. Working with the venues, the Sales Supervisor will create a partnership with the box office/sales teams to learn from their approaches, and to educate the teams with DTG’s revenue and inventory management principles.

The Sales Supervisor (in conjunction with Senior management) will create pricing and sales strategies which includes group sales, accessibility and education outreach. They will track and update revenue forecasts and weekly sales goals for each market alongside detailed and accurate sales analysis and reporting to guide DTG sales and marketing teams from all levels.

Responsibilities

Sales

  • Lead any on sales, including preparing a detailed pricing/seat configuration documentation
  • Provide strategy and guidance for venue box offices to ensure sales are maximized at all times
  • Proof and test all ticketing set up prior to on sale ensuring each season is accurately set up to avoid revenue loss
  • Monitor advance sales to identify challenge periods to ensure these receive relevant marketing and promotional support
  • Lead internal meetings, marketing agency and venue meetings alongside Marketing team ensuring planning progresses and information is communicated to the benefit of all DTG teams
  • Representing DTG Sales & Ticketing Analytics department at trade events and industry meetings and general liaison and relationship building with ticket agents

Revenue & Inventory Management

  • Proactively monitor all sales to ensure pricing is in line with demand so that revenue can be maximized
  • Manage sales at discounted rates, ensuring these are applied for suitable performances and inventory, with the overall purpose of increasing revenue and attendance
  • Inform and educate venue revenue management teams on pricing strategy and gain a detailed understanding of any venue revenue management systems in order to approve all pricing implementations from such systems
  • Supervise the venue management of the inventory to maximize sales and optimize revenue, this includes the release of holds and the masking of inventory as and when required to encourage sales
  • Create a strategic approach to our Education Outreach ticket allocations ensuring minimal revenue loss and optimal attendance gain
  • Support the London productions as required

Reporting & Analysis

  • Working closely with DTG Marketing, update weekly sales forecasts based on sales trends and marketing activities
  • Maintain reporting files for each season ensuring they are fully operational; this could include some data formatting prior each on sale
  • Distribute sales reports with particular focus on presenting sales data and communicating sales strategies to DTG EMEA Senior management and DTG NY
  • Compile any ad hoc reports and analysis as required

Other

  • Proof read all sales information on websites and other marketing material to ensure pricing, performance dates/times and access information is accurate
  • Supervise any special events (opening nights, trade events etc.) ensuring relevant information is shared with key sales partners /guests
  • Manage house seat allocations and release schedule to ensure inventory is available for sale via relevant sales channels
